Abstract

A self-propelled construction machine comprises a control unit configured in such a way that a point of reference on the construction machine moves along a route. A processing unit is configured in such a way that the position of at least one kink on the target route is determined from the imported data, at least a portion of the target route is displayed, and, for the section of the target route in which the target route has the kink, an interpolation curve that is substantially free of kinks is calculated. The relevant section of the target route is replaced by the interpolation curve for the determination of a modelled route. The control of the drive device is then not based upon the predetermined target route, but rather the modelled target route.
